World Health Expo to kick off in Wuhan
The 2023 World Health Expo will kick off in Wuhan, Hubei province on April 7, according to organizers. The date coincides with World Health Day.
The four-day expo will be jointly held by the Hubei provincial government, the National Health Commission and the Wuhan municipal government.
It is expected to attract more than 1,000 enterprises and a number of academicians, hospital administrators and experts to demonstrate new products and discuss developments in the field of health.
The first expo of its kind was held in 2019. Since then, the event has been held annually and is the only national-level expo in the sector.
Mao Qun'an, head of the commission's department of planning and information, said during a news conference on Sunday the health expo has become an important platform to strengthen communication and promote development of the health industry, and is conductive to deepening opening up of the health sector.
The opening day of this year's expo was chosen to overlap with World Health Day to spread awareness about healthy lives across society, he added.
